CCP-Linked Companies Shock U.S.: Buying Military Academies at Alarming Rate

Rep. Mike Waltz (R-FL) is sounding the alarm about an unsettling trend of companies with close ties to the Chinese Communist Party buying up U.S. military academies, including the one attended by Donald Trump when he was a teenager.

In a letter to Secretary of Defense Lloyd Austin, Waltz requested that the Department of Defense survey all Army, Navy, and Air Force JROTC programs held in private schools across the country to determine “whether those schools are owned by a subsidiary of a foreign company, and the name of the subsidiary and foreign company.” Waltz’s request stems from a concern that these military school acquisitions are part of China’s “Belt & Road Initiative” to assert its influence in the United States education system.
